Biography
Gaétan Laroche is a professor of materials engineering, internationally recognized for his work on the surface modification of materials using plasmas at atmospheric pressure. D. in chemistry from Université Laval, he applies his knowledge to establish correlations between the electrical and energetic characteristics of plasmas and the resulting modifications to the surface of materials treated in these highly reactive environments. This understanding is used to develop strategies for the surface modification of vascular and orthopedic biomaterials to improve their biocompatibility.
